    After reading this and other threads I wasn't hopeful.

    but had a thought.

    I had just deleted a heap of photos, perhaps the system was jamming up because it was saving those deleted shots in case I had made an error.

    this may be part of the updated photos app.

    After emptying the recycle bin I was able to import 2047 images without issue.

    given my system has 16gb ram and tons of processor speed these issues rarely present for me.
